Abstract: | The flexural vibrations and dissipative heating of a circular bimorph piezoceramic plate are studied. The plate is excited
by a harmonic electric field applied to nonuniformly electroded surfaces. The viscoelastic behavior of piezoceramics is described
in terms of temperature-dependent complex moduli. The nonlinear coupled problem of thermoviscoelasticity is solved by step-by-step
integration in time, using the discrete-orthogonalization method to solve the mechanics equations and the finite-differences
method to solve the heat-conduction equations. A numerical analysis is conducted for TsTStBS-2 piezoceramics to study the
influence of the nonuniform electroding on the resonant frequency, amplitude, and modes of flexural vibrations and the amplitude-
and temperature-frequency characteristics of the plate
